  1. Solana Beach is a coastal city in San Diego County, California. Its population was at 12,940 at the 2020 U.S. Census, up from 12,867 at the 2010 Census. [5] History. The area was first settled by the San Dieguitos, early Holocene inhabitants of the area.

  8. Solana Beach started as a farming community with gorgeous bluffs overlooking the ocean, but with no beach access. Later on, a gap was cut out in the bluffs, providing access to the ocean. The beachfront is divided into four main Beach Parks: Fletcher Cove, Tide Beach Park, Seascape Surf, and Del Mar Shores.

  9. ABOUT SOLANA BEACH. Solana Beach History. First Inhabitants from 9000 BC until 1862. Evidence shows that the earliest inhabitants of the bluffs and rolling hills of Solana Beach, arrived in 9000 BC. Now known as the San Dieguitos, they were hunters of mastodons, giant bison, and camels.
